GOVERNOR PATRICK MORRISEY ANNOUNCES PERFORMANCE AUDITS FOR STATE AGENCIES

CHARLESTON, W.Va. – Today, Governor Patrick Morrisey announced the winning bid of a contract to complete performance evaluations of state agencies. One of the country’s leading accounting and advisory firms, BDO USA, P.C., was selected to conduct independent performance evaluations of the Department of Human Services, Department of Homeland Security, and the Department of Transportation. WAG Trap-Neuter-Return on September 8

On Monday, September 8, 2025, the Welfare of Animals Group (WAG) will be humanely trapping feral cats in the Five Forks area to have them spayed/neutered, vaccinated, and ear tipped (the universal sign that a cat has been part of a Trap-Neuter-Return program).
